SUSTAINABILITY
WHAT IS SUSTAINABILITY
Sustainability focuses on meeting the needs of the present without compromising the ability of future generations to meet their needs. Sustainability is made up of three pillars: economic, social and environmental
WHAT DOES IT MEAN TO US
1. TO MANUFACTURE OUR PIECES IN A FACILITY THAT EMPOWERS AND SUPPORTS ITS LOCAL COMMUNITY: SOCIALLY AND ECONOMICALLY
-
AT OUR PRODUCTION FACILITY
- 61 of the 62 employees live within a 30km radius.- Most of the employees have been working on the same facility for numerous years.
- All outsourced services are done by local businesses.
- The factory invests in the future of its local industry by organizing workshops and training courses to young students who want to learn about the art of goldsmith.
- All raw materials are solely sourced from local suppliers.

3. TO CREATE OUR PRODUCTS FROM MATERIALS THAT ARE ETHICALLY SOURCED AND ARE NOT DAMAGING TO THE ENVIRONMENT.
-
AT OUR PRODUCTION FACILITY
- Precious metals are sourced strictly from local companies that acquire ethical and ecological certifications. This en- sures that the raw materials are 100% ethical; they do not come from a warzone area or from a mine in which, minors are exploited or from places that the environment is not respected.
- Precious metals are recycled on a daily basis. Our factory has the capability of collecting their daily manufacturing waste, melting it and reproducing it.
ALL OF OUR PRODUCTS CONTAIN A HIGH PERCENTAGE OF RECYCLED METAL.
4. TO ACHIEVE QUALITY THROUGH PROCESSES, WHICH ARE NEITHER HARMFUL TO THE LOCAL ECOSYSTEM NOR THEY GENERATE EXCESSIVE WASTE.
-
AT OUR PRODUCTION FACILITY
- We are mindful with water.
- We recycle waste.
- We do not use any harmful chemicals during production. The factory uses ecological acid for the cleaning of the oxides.
- We do constant efforts to reduce the plastic consumption. Whenever possible the use of plastic products is being substituted by reusable products.
